The Different Types of Yoga Poses

Yoga poses, or asanas, are the physical postures that are practiced in yoga. There are many different types of yoga poses, each with its own benefits and challenges. Some of the most common types of yoga poses include:

Standing Poses

Standing poses are some of the most basic yoga poses. They help improve posture, balance, and strength. Some common standing poses include:

  • Mountain Pose
  • Warrior I, II, and III
  • Tree Pose

Seated Poses

Seated poses are done while sitting on the ground. They help improve flexibility and promote relaxation. Some common seated poses include:

  • Easy Pose
  • Seated Forward Bend
  • Bound Angle Pose

Backbends

Backbends help improve posture, flexibility, and spinal health. They can be challenging, but they are also very rewarding. Some common backbends include:

  • Cobra Pose
  • Upward Facing Dog
  • Bridge Pose

Forward Bends

Forward bends help release tension in the back, neck, and shoulders. They also help improve flexibility in the hamstrings and hips. Some common forward bends include:

  • Child’s Pose
  • Seated Forward Bend
  • Standing Forward Bend

Twists

Twists help improve digestion and relieve tension in the back and hips. They can also help improve spinal health. Some common twists include:

  • Supine Twist
  • Seated Twist
  • Half Lord of the Fishes Pose

Inversions

Inversions are poses where the head is below the heart. They help improve circulation, boost the immune system, and promote relaxation. Inversions can be challenging, but they are also very rewarding. Some common inversions include:

  • Downward Facing Dog
  • Headstand
  • Shoulderstand

There is no definitive answer to this question, as the number of yoga poses is constantly evolving. However, it is estimated that there are over 300 different yoga poses. Some of these poses are more challenging than others, and some are better for beginners. It’s important to work with a trained yoga teacher to develop a safe and effective yoga practice.
